About Edith B. Allen

Edith B. Allen is a scholar working on Plant Science, Nature and Landscape Conservation, Ecology, Soil Science and Global and Planetary Change, having authored 147 papers that have together received 8.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Ecology and Vegetation Dynamics Studies (71 papers), Mycorrhizal Fungi and Plant Interactions (59 papers), Rangeland and Wildlife Management (47 papers), Soil Carbon and Nitrogen Dynamics (29 papers), Fire effects on ecosystems (22 papers), Forest Ecology and Biodiversity Studies (21 papers), Peatlands and Wetlands Ecology (18 papers) and Botany, Ecology, and Taxonomy Studies (17 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Nature and Landscape Conservation (3.6k citations), Soil Science (1.7k citations), Plant Science (4.5k citations), Insect Science (1.4k citations) and Ecology (2.7k citations). Edith B. Allen has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Mexico and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Michael F. Allen, Louise M. Egerton‐Warburton, Nancy Collins Johnson, Lea Corkidi, Diane Rowland, T. Meixner, Robert D. Cox, Leela E. Rao, Mark E. Fenn and Pamela E. Padgett. Their work appears in journals such as Restoration Ecology, Mycorrhiza, Ecological Applications, Plant Ecology and Journal of Arid Environments.
